The Redemptive Power of Love in Maroon 5's 'Lost'

Maroon 5's song 'Lost' delves into the transformative experience of finding love after a period of aimlessness and despair. The lyrics express a profound sense of disconnection and a lack of purpose, which is a common human experience. The protagonist of the song feels adrift, searching for something or someone to give meaning to their existence. The repetition of 'searching and searching' emphasizes the intensity and desperation of this quest.

The turning point in the song comes with the introduction of a significant other's love, which acts as a beacon of hope and salvation. The phrase 'I was lost till you loved me' suggests that the protagonist's life has gained new meaning through this relationship. The love they receive brings them to a 'safe' and 'sound' place, both literally and metaphorically, indicating a sense of security and peace that was previously missing. The use of the words 'swept up in a wave' could symbolize being overwhelmed by life's challenges, but in the context of the song, it also conveys the idea of being carried away by the powerful force of love.

Maroon 5 is known for their pop-rock sound and their ability to capture complex emotional experiences in catchy, relatable tunes. 'Lost' is a testament to their musical style, with its melodic hooks and heartfelt lyrics. The song resonates with anyone who has felt the redemptive power of love, whether it be romantic, familial, or platonic. It's a reminder that even in our darkest moments, connection with others can lead us back to ourselves.
